A Michigan State University (MSU) student was killed and another student was seriously injured after the Mercury Mountaineer they were riding in hit a cement guardrail and fell into the Red Cedar River. The accident occurred on Cedar Street near Elm Street. It was not clear the cause of the accident, but police say a tire was flat on the vehicle when I was pulled out of the water. According to witnesses, the Mountaineer was airborne for nearly 100 feet before plunging into the Red Cedar River. The driver was pronounced dead at Sparrow Hospital while the passenger was released after being treated for unspecified injuries.
